The Reinswald ski area is located around three kilometres from the Almhotel Bergerhof and can be reached within just a few minutes by car. There, you will find varied slopes, a ski school, ski rental facilities and welcoming mountain huts where you can stop for refreshments.
The Reinswald ski area is popular not only with holidaymakers. International World Cup skiers also regularly use the slopes in the Sarntal Valley for their training.
